Is it alright to take over the counter sleep aids with Vicodin?
Over the counter sleep-aid medications are fine to take with Vicodin as long as you are not taking more than 4000 mg of Tylenol in a 24 hour period of time. Too much Tylenol can kill your liver, so keep track of the amounts. One Vicodin (5/500) pill has 500 mg of Tylenol. If you are near the limit of Tylenol, you can try Benadryl for sleep.
